The Rise of Artificial Intelligence in Data Analysis
Artificial Intelligence (AI) has become a cornerstone of modern data analysis, marking a significant shift from traditional analytical methods. With AI, data analysis has transcended the limitations of human processing, bringing forth exponential growth in capabilities. The incorporation of machine learning algorithms enables the handling of vast datasets with remarkable precision and speed. Moreover, AI allows for enhanced predictive analytics, offering unprecedented accuracy in forecasting. These advancements highlight the current trends in data analysis, as they manifest in real-time insights and accelerated decision-making processes. Furthermore, AI-driven tools and platforms have become more accessible, democratizing data analysis to a wider audience. Consequently, organizations, regardless of their size, can leverage these technologies to optimize operations, enhance customer experiences, and drive innovation. As AI continues to evolve, its integration into data analysis frameworks is set to redefine the scope and efficacy of data-driven strategies.

Ethical Considerations in Data Analysis
As data analysis becomes increasingly sophisticated, the ethical considerations surrounding its practice have gained prominence. Ethical issues in data analysis encompass a range of concerns, from data privacy and consent to algorithmic bias and transparency. These issues underscore current trends in data analysis, where the focus is shifting towards responsible and sustainable practices. Organizations and policymakers are now tasked with ensuring that data-driven decisions do not compromise individual rights or perpetuate existing biases. To address these concerns, measures such as anonymization, compliance with data protection regulations, and developing ethical guidelines are being implemented. As a part of the current trends in data analysis, there is a growing advocacy for ethical training and awareness among data professionals. This paradigm shift reflects a broader recognition of the social implications of data work, thus integrating ethics as a foundational component of modern data analysis strategies.

The Role of Quantum Computing
Quantum computing represents the frontier of innovation within the framework of current trends in data analysis. Its potential to process complex computations exponentially faster than classical computers promises to redefine data analysis methodologies. By leveraging quantum bits or qubits, quantum computing powers an unprecedented scale of parallel computation. This capability holds the promise of transforming cryptography, optimization problems, and simulations, which are integral components of complex data analysis tasks. Moreover, while still in nascent stages, the integration of quantum computing in data analysis frameworks exemplifies the exploratory nature of current trends in data analysis. Research and investment in quantum technologies are intensifying globally, as organizations seek to harness its potential to tackle existing computational limitations. Additionally, partnerships between tech corporations and academic institutions catalyze the development of quantum-ready algorithms, fueling innovation. Despite its promise, challenges remain, including issues of error correction and the need for specialized talent. Nonetheless, the trajectory of quantum computing continues to captivate the scholarly and industrial sectors, highlighting its role in shaping the future landscape of data analysis.
Machine Learning Algorithms
The deployment of machine learning algorithms is a defining characteristic of current trends in data analysis. These algorithms enable the automation of data processing, transforming raw data into actionable insights. Supervised, unsupervised, and reinforcement learning approaches each offer unique benefits. Supervised learning, typically used for classification and regression tasks, informs predictive analytics with high accuracy. Unsupervised learning facilitates clustering and anomaly detection, uncovering hidden patterns within datasets. Meanwhile, reinforcement learning algorithms excel in dynamic environments, optimizing decision processes iteratively. As state-of-the-art solutions, these algorithms underpin initiatives across sectors such as finance, healthcare, and marketing, driving innovation and efficiency.
